Player Story

Ja'Quinden Jackson story

Ja'Quinden Jackson built his college career from 2020 through 2024 as a running back from Dallas, TX wearing No. 22, spending time with Arkansas, Texas, and Utah. The clearest part of Ja'Quinden Jackson's career was his backfield work: 2,148 rushing yards, 394 carries, 29 rushing touchdowns, and 200 receiving yards across 35 career games in the available record. His largest box-score season came in 2024 with Arkansas. Those numbers show where he fit, how often the ball or action found him, and how his role developed over time.
